IINSA·UB researchers named members of the AESAN Scientific Committee

Two researchers from the Institute of Nutrition and Food Safety of the University of Barcelona ( ) –which is an associate of the Barcelona Science Park– have been named as members of the Scientific Committee of the Spanish Agency for Food Safety and Nutrition (AESAN). The two are: Albert Bosch, the head of the Enteric Virus Group who was already a member of the committee and has had his place renewed; and M. Carme Vidal, head of the Food Amines and Polyamines Group, who joins the committee for the first time.

The Scientific Committee of AESAN is responsible for providing the necessary scientific advice for the Agency to carry out its remit, by issuing reports from the group of experts.

The committee currently has 20 members who are recognised experts in areas related to food safety: Food Toxicology; Microbiology, Virology, Parasitology and Food Zoonoses; Human and Animal Epidemiology; Biotechnology and Genetic Modification; Immunology and Allergies; Human Nutrition; Pharmacology; Food Technology Processes; and Analysis and Instrumentation.
